RedHat7修改Yum源 RedHat 7 操作系统中,Yum 源是非常重要的组件之一。Yum 源提供了软件包的下载和安装功能,但是在某些情况下,可能需要修改 Yum 源来解决问题或提高下载速度。阿里云镜像站是一个非常流行的镜像站点,提供了大量的软件包,这篇文章将指导你如何将 RedHat 7 的 Yum 源修改为阿里云镜像站。 第一步:查看已安装的 Yum 包 在 RedHat 7 中,可以使用以下命令来查看已安装的 Yum 包: rpm -qa | grep yum 这将显示当前系统中已经安装的 Yum 包的列表。 第二步:删除所有的 Yum 包 在修改 Yum 源之前,需要删除所有的 Yum 包,以免出现冲突。可以使用以下命令来删除所有的 Yum 包: rpm -qa | grep yum | xargs rpm -e --nodeps 这将删除所有的 Yum 包,包括依赖包。 第三步:卸载 python-urlgrabber 包 python-urlgrabber 是一个 Yum 的依赖包,需要单独卸载。可以使用以下命令来卸载 python-urlgrabber 包: rpm -qa | grep python-urlgrabber rpm -e --nodeps python-urlgrabber 第四步:下载所需的安装包 从阿里云镜像站下载所需的安装包,包括 yum-rhn-plugin、yum-utils、yum-langpacks、yum-metadata-parser 和 PackageKit 等包。可以使用以下命令来下载: wget https://mirrors.aliyun.com/centos/7/os/x86_64/Packages/yum-rhn-plugin-2.0.1-10.el7.noarch.rpm wget https://mirrors.aliyun.com/centos/7/os/x86_64/Packages/PackageKit-1.1.10-2.el7.centos.x86_64.rpm wget https://mirrors.aliyun.com/centos/7/os/x86_64/Packages/python-urlgrabber-3.10-10.el7.noarch.rpm wget https://mirrors.aliyun.com/centos/7/os/x86_64/Packages/yum-3.4.3-168.el7.centos.noarch.rpm wget https://mirrors.aliyun.com/centos/7/os/x86_64/Packages/yum-utils-1.1.31-54.el7_8.noarch.rpm wget https://mirrors.aliyun.com/centos/7/os/x86_64/Packages/yum-langpacks-0.4.2-7.el7.noarch.rpm wget https://mirrors.aliyun.com/centos/7/os/x86_64/Packages/yum-metadata-parser-1.1.4-10.el7.x86_64.rpm 第五步:安装所有下载的包 使用以下命令来安装所有下载的包: rpm -ivh yum-* --force --nodeps 第六步:下载阿里镜像到/etc/yum.repos.d目录下 使用以下命令来下载阿里镜像到/etc/yum.repos.d目录下: w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o 然后,修改刚下载的文件,将所有 releasever 替换为 7: vim /etc/yum.repos.d/CentOS-Base.repo :%s/releasever/7/g 执行以下命令来更新 Yum 缓存: yum clean all yum makecache yum update 使用 yum repolist all 查看可用的仓库,RedHat 7 的 Yum 源已经修改为阿里云镜像站。 修改 RedHat 7 的 Yum 源需要删除所有的 Yum 包,卸载 python-urlgrabber 包,下载所需的安装包,安装所有下载的包,下载阿里镜像到/etc/yum.repos.d目录下,最后更新 Yum 缓存。
- 粉丝: 1
- 资源: 10
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助